GÜLİSTAN

Lukas Birk and Natasha Christia

Publisher
Fraglich Publishing
Year
2021
Specifications
10 x 15 cm
64 pages
Edition of 300

GÜLİSTAN tells the story of Kenan and Filiz, two residents of Istanbul celebrating their lives through the city's finest establishments in the 1960s and 70s. Those establishments offered foto servisi, and presented the results to their clientele in fashionable envelopes.

The book offers a subtle resistance to the currently conservative forces in Turkey, showing a time of westward thinking in the city, together with an insight into the bustling world of yesterday's Istanbul and a very peculiar practice that is still part of every family's own store of pictures.
